Synthesis of Niobium Carbide from Niobium Oxide Aerogels

Chemistry of Materials, 1995
Niobium carbide (NbC) synthesis was studied by the temperature-programmed reaction (TPR) between niobium oxide precursors of different textural properties and a 20% (v/v) CH{sub 4}-H{sub 2} mixture. Surface areas ranging between 13 and 74 m{sup 2}/g were obtained depending on the temperature and on the nature of the precursor (Nb{sub 2}O{sub 5} or an ...

Hardness anisotropy in niobium carbide

Journal of Materials Science, 1974
Measurements of hardness anisotropy by Knoop diamond indentation on the {100} surfaces of Nb6C5 crystals show that the hardness is determined by crystallographic slip on {111} 〈1¯10〉 and {110} 〈1¯10〉 systems. {111} is the preferred slip plane for Nb6C5 and crystals with higher carbon content which show a marked decrease in Knoop hardness.
